open-next-cdk
Version:
Deploy a NextJS app using OpenNext packaging to serverless AWS using CDK
21 lines • 3.85 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
// L2 constructs
var NextjsAssetsDeployment_1 = require("./NextjsAssetsDeployment");
Object.defineProperty(exports, "NextJsAssetsDeployment", { enumerable: true, get: function () { return NextjsAssetsDeployment_1.NextJsAssetsDeployment; } });
var NextjsBuild_1 = require("./NextjsBuild");
Object.defineProperty(exports, "NextjsBuild", { enumerable: true, get: function () { return NextjsBuild_1.NextjsBuild; } });
var NextjsLambda_1 = require("./NextjsLambda");
Object.defineProperty(exports, "NextJsLambda", { enumerable: true, get: function () { return NextjsLambda_1.NextJsLambda; } });
var ImageOptimizationLambda_1 = require("./ImageOptimizationLambda");
Object.defineProperty(exports, "ImageOptimizationLambda", { enumerable: true, get: function () { return ImageOptimizationLambda_1.ImageOptimizationLambda; } });
var NextjsS3EnvRewriter_1 = require("./NextjsS3EnvRewriter");
Object.defineProperty(exports, "NextjsS3EnvRewriter", { enumerable: true, get: function () { return NextjsS3EnvRewriter_1.NextjsS3EnvRewriter; } });
var NextjsLayer_1 = require("./NextjsLayer");
Object.defineProperty(exports, "NextjsLayer", { enumerable: true, get: function () { return NextjsLayer_1.NextjsLayer; } });
var NextjsDistribution_1 = require("./NextjsDistribution");
Object.defineProperty(exports, "NextjsDistribution", { enumerable: true, get: function () { return NextjsDistribution_1.NextjsDistribution; } });
// L3 constructs
var Nextjs_1 = require("./Nextjs");
Object.defineProperty(exports, "Nextjs", { enumerable: true, get: function () { return Nextjs_1.Nextjs; } });
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iaW5kZXguanMiLCJzb3VyY2VSb290IjoiIiwic291cmNlcyI6WyIuLi9zcmMvaW5kZXgudHMi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6Ijs7QUFPQSxnQkFBZ0I7QUFDaEIsbUVBS2tDO0FBSmhDLGdJQUFBLHNCQUFzQixPQUFBO0FBS3hCLDZDQUFpRjtBQUF4RSwwR0FBQSxXQUFXLE9BQUE7QUFDcEIsK0NBQWtGO0FBQXhELDRHQUFBLFlBQVksT0FBQTtBQUN0QyxxRUFBNEY7QUFBbkYsa0lBQUEsdUJBQXVCLE9BQUE7QUFDaEMsNkRBSytCO0FBSjdCLDBIQUFBLG1CQUFtQixPQUFBO0FBS3JCLDZDQUE4RDtBQUFyRCwwR0FBQSxXQUFXLE9BQUE7QUFDcEIsMkRBUzhCO0FBUjVCLHdIQUFBLGtCQUFrQixPQUFBO0FBVXBCLGdCQUFnQjtBQUNoQixtQ0FBb0U7QUFBM0QsZ0dBQUEsTUFBTSxPQUFBIiwic291cmNlc0NvbnRlbnQiOlsiZXhwb3J0IHtcbiAgQmFzZVNpdGVFbnZpcm9ubWVudE91dHB1dHNJbmZvLFxuICBCYXNlU2l0ZVJlcGxhY2VQcm9wcyxcbiAgQmFzZVNpdGVEb21haW5Qcm9wcyxcbiAgTmV4dGpzQmFzZVByb3BzLFxufSBmcm9tICcuL05leHRqc0Jhc2UnO1xuXG4vLyBMMiBjb25zdHJ1Y3RzXG5leHBvcnQge1xuICBOZXh0SnNBc3NldHNEZXBsb3ltZW50LFxuICBOZXh0anNBc3NldHNEZXBsb3ltZW50UHJvcHMsXG4gIE5leHRqc0Fzc2V0c0RlcGxveW1lbnRQcm9wc0RlZmF1bHRzLFxuICBOZXh0anNBc3NldHNDYWNoZVBvbGljeVByb3BzLFxufSBmcm9tICcuL05leHRqc0Fzc2V0c0RlcGxveW1lbnQnO1xuZXhwb3J0IHsgTmV4dGpzQnVpbGQsIE5leHRqc0J1aWxkUHJvcHMsIENyZWF0ZUFyY2hpdmVBcmdzIH0gZnJvbSAnLi9OZXh0anNCdWlsZCc7XG5leHBvcnQgeyBFbnZpcm9ubWVudFZhcnMsIE5leHRKc0xhbWJkYSwgTmV4dGpzTGFtYmRhUHJvcHMgfSBmcm9tICcuL05leHRqc0xhbWJkYSc7XG5leHBvcnQgeyBJbWFnZU9wdGltaXphdGlvbkxhbWJkYSwgSW1hZ2VPcHRpbWl6YXRpb25Qcm9wcyB9IGZyb20gJy4vSW1hZ2VPcHRpbWl6YXRpb25MYW1iZGEnO1xuZXhwb3J0IHtcbiAgTmV4dGpzUzNFbnZSZXdyaXRlcixcbiAgTmV4dGpzUzNFbnZSZXdyaXRlclByb3BzLFxuICBSZXdyaXRlclBhcmFtcyxcbiAgUmV3cml0ZVJlcGxhY2VtZW50c0NvbmZpZyxcbn0gZnJvbSAnLi9OZXh0anNTM0VudlJld3JpdGVyJztcbmV4cG9ydCB7IE5leHRqc0xheWVyLCBOZXh0anNMYXllclByb3BzIH0gZnJvbSAnLi9OZXh0anNMYXllcic7XG5leHBvcnQge1xuICBOZXh0anNEaXN0cmlidXRpb24sXG4gIE5leHRqc0Rpc3RyaWJ1dGlvbkNka1Byb3BzLFxuICBOZXh0anNEaXN0cmlidXRpb25DZGtPdmVycmlkZVByb3BzLFxuICBOZXh0anNEaXN0cmlidXRpb25Qcm9wcyxcbiAgTmV4dGpzRGlzdHJpYnV0aW9uUHJvcHNEZWZhdWx0cyxcbiAgTmV4dGpzRG9tYWluUHJvcHMsXG4gIE5leHRqc0NhY2hlUG9saWN5UHJvcHMsXG4gIE5leHRqc09yaWdpblJlcXVlc3RQb2xpY3lQcm9wcyxcbn0gZnJvbSAnLi9OZXh0anNEaXN0cmlidXRpb24nO1xuXG4vLyBMMyBjb25zdHJ1Y3RzXG5leHBvcnQgeyBOZXh0anMsIE5leHRqc1Byb3BzLCBOZXh0anNEZWZhdWx0c1Byb3BzIH0gZnJvbSAnLi9OZXh0anMnO1xuIl19